About Gallivant

Gallivant is an independent perfume brand based in London, created by Nick Steward and officially launched on 8 March 2017, International Women’s Day. Steward brought to the project more than two decades of industry experience, including a period as product and creative director at L’Artisan Parfumeur and earlier roles with beauty groups such as Puig and L’Oréal. From the outset Gallivant focused on compact, travel-friendly bottles and a tightly edited collection of unisex scents.

The core concept is city-inspired perfumery. Each fragrance is built around a specific urban destination that has personal meaning for Steward, starting with London, Brooklyn, Tel Aviv and Istanbul in the initial launch collection, with Amsterdam and Berlin following soon after. Later additions have included Tokyo and other locations, all composed with independent perfumers at Art et Parfum in Cabris, near Grasse. The concentrates are developed in France and the finished products are handmade in the United Kingdom.

Gallivant emphasizes a “small, independent business” approach: vegan formulas, cruelty free production, and a stated focus on thoughtful material choices, combining naturals with synthetics as appropriate. The brand positions its scents as quietly composed rather than ostentatious, aligning with a slow, deliberate development process rather than high-volume launches. Its perfumes have received multiple awards and are now stocked in numerous countries, while retaining the founder-led, London-based structure that defined the brand at launch.

Scent DNA

Citrus Woody Aromatic Musky Floral
  • Gallivant scents tend to be nuanced and urbane rather than overpowering, with an emphasis on atmosphere and sense of place over overt sensuality or heavy sweetness
  • They often balance contemporary musks, airy woods and crisp citruses with a few carefully chosen accents that suggest specific neighborhoods, climates or times of day
  • The overall style is clean, wearable and restrained, designed to be lived in rather than to dominate a room

Brand Evolution

Gallivant began in 2017 with a compact set of six city fragrances and a strong emphasis on 30 ml travel-sized bottles. Over time, the brand has expanded its map to include additional cities and refined its storytelling around urban exploration and slow travel. While the core DNA of unisex, understated compositions has remained, later releases often show slightly more complexity and bolder contrasts, reflecting a growing confidence in working with different perfumers and materials.
